The special Roku Gin set menu at The Nest in One Farrer is a beautifully-composed gourmet showcase of the botanicals used in the making of the Japanese gin.

Located on the top floor of One Farrer Hotel, The Nest is an exclusive space the hotel specially repurposed for private dining. One of the newest gourmet experiences offered by The Nest is specially-curated set menu that features pairing with cocktails made with Roku Gin.

Diners looking specifically for privacy in a cosy, intimate space can avail themselves to this five-course Roku Gin pairing set menu. Created by the award-winning culinary team at The Nest, each dish featured in the set was inspired by the six botanicals used in the making of Roku Gin.

If you’re not familiar with Roku Gin, this is an award-winning Japanese gin from the House of Suntory. It uses botanicals unique to Japan – Sencha tea, Gyokuro tea, Sanshō pepper, yuzu peel, as well as the flowers and leaves of the iconic sakura, which is why spring season is important to Roku Gin.

Dishes include an elegant Snow Crab Timbale filled with fresh crab meat that’s tossed through with a citrus aioli, then topped with a salted cream foam along with sakura and lychee jelly, as well as the Chicken Consommé, its broth delicately infused with Sencha while the chicken gyoza bursts with flavours of truffle and charred spring onion.

Continuing the gin-inspired epicurean journey is Crumble Black Cod (pictured above). This is beautifully pan-seared cod with a butter caper sauce lends silky creaminess and a salty tang to lift the flavours of the fish.

After you cleanse your palate with a sorbet made with Roku Gin, cold compressed watermelon and Gyokuro tea, you’ll move on to the Black Angus Beef Short Ribs. Splendidly fork-tender, the beef rib comes smothered in an unctuous bone marrow jus along with sunchoke puree and topped with a piece of foie gras, broccolini, and garnished with a tempura sakura leaf.

End the meal with the Cronut, an elevated version of the croissant-donut hybrid that is filled with red bean and matcha, and served alongside yuzu ice cream.

And don’t forget the cocktails! The meal comes along with six tipples that form a riot of colours and flavours. Cocktail creations include Kanpai, comprising of sour mix, soda water, and Roku Gin, and Okawari, which combines the gin with cranberry juice and lemon juice. You’ll have plenty of fun trying to pair each cocktail with the different dishes on offer.
